
Turkey Hill Iced Tea, Lemonade
What You Should Know
Turkey Hill Iced Tea, Lemonade (64 fl oz) is a ready-to-drink, value-sized bottled beverage that sits squarely in the refrigerated or chilled beverage section of the grocery store—usually beside other bottled teas, lemonades, juice blends, and large-format soft drinks. You’ll see it in family-size coolers near deli and dairy aisles or on lower shelves of the beverage cooler alongside jug-style lemonades and sweet tea offerings. It’s positioned as an everyday, family-friendly refresher: the label leans on wholesome, homey language and “bottled cold” freshness claims, bright citrus imagery, and the brand’s familiar logo to evoke comfort and tradition rather than premium artisanal credentials. The packaging is a plastic 64-oz jug with a wide pour spout, meant for the fridge and for pouring over ice into glasses or a pitcher for gatherings. Sensory cues include an immediately sweet, syrupy mouthfeel, pronounced lemon-citrus top notes with a background of mild tea tannin, and an amber-to-golden hue colored by beta carotene; the aroma is sugary lemon with processed tea undertones. Rituals around use are communal and practical—grab-and-pour at backyard barbecues, family dinners, or as a fridge staple for kids after school. Label characteristics emphasize convenience and taste (“natural flavors,” bottled cold) but do not claim organic or clean-label status; there are preservative and sweetener ingredients on the panel. In plain terms, this is an industrially formulated, shelf-stable-style flavored tea-lemonade product made for mass consumption rather than homemade preparation.

Ultra-Processing Assessment
Ultra-Processed
Why this score?
Contains multiple industrial ingredients (high fructose corn syrup, preservatives, natural flavors, color) and is a ready-to-drink formulation, characteristics of NOVA group 4 ultraprocessed foods.
